Important Considerations When Choosing: Verify Insurance Coverage: Even if a clinic states they take insurance, it's crucial to: Call your insurance provider directly. Confirm that the specific clinic and the services you need (evaluation, medication management, therapy) are covered under your plan. Ask about deductibles, co-pays, and co-insurance. Understand your out-of-pocket costs. Inquire about out-of-network benefits if the clinic isn't in your network, as some plans offer partial coverage. Licensing and Credentials: Ensure the clinicians are licensed in your state and have appropriate credentials (MD, DO, NP, LCSW, etc.) for diagnosing and treating ADHD. Treatment Approach: Understand their approach to treatment. Do they focus solely on medication, or do they offer therapy, coaching, or other behavioral interventions? Patient Reviews: Look for reviews from other patients to get a sense of their experience with the clinic's services, communication, and effectiveness. State Availability: Confirm that the clinic provides services in your specific state, as licensing laws vary.
